Saturday 22nd July:

Got up at daylight and did some fishing off the beach in front of Deb's place. I caught two small size bream and Ferg pulled in two mud crabs, also too small. It was good to get the lines wet at long last. Later in the morning we went into Mossman Market. It is very small but quite interesting as it is set up under some enormous raintrees.

Sunday 23rd July:

Went in early to the Port Douglas Markets to beat the tourists from Cairns. They have certainly grown over the past few years and there are some very colourful stalls. Back a Cooya we started packing up as we are heading off tomorrow for Cooktown. We enjoyed a lovely long walk along the beach in the afternoon. It's been great staying here with Deb. Unfortunately I don't think the peace will last here as the developers have got their hands on a large block of land behind the beach. So next time we pass this way I imagine the place will be a lot busier.
